Personal Loans
Personal loans are a common choice for debt consolidation, as they offer flexibility and convenience. These loans can be obtained from various financial institutions, including banks and online lenders. With a personal loan, you can borrow a lump sum of money to pay off your debts, and then repay the loan over a fixed period, typically with fixed monthly payments.
Some advantages of personal loans for debt consolidation include:
No collateral required: Personal loans are generally unsecured, which means you don’t have to put up any collateral, such as your home or car.
Fixed interest rates: Personal loans often come with fixed interest rates, so you won’t have to worry about your monthly payments fluctuating.
Simplified payments: By consolidating your debts into one personal loan, you’ll only have to make a single monthly payment, making it easier to keep track of your finances.

Home Equity Loans
If you own a home, you may have the option to use a home equity loan for debt consolidation. A home equity loan allows you to borrow against the equity you have built up in your home. This type of loan is secured by your property, which means that if you fail to make payments, you could potentially lose your home.
Consider the following advantages of using a home equity loan for debt consolidation:
Potentially lower interest rates: Home equity loans often come with lower interest rates compared to other types of loans, which can save you money in the long run.
Higher borrowing limits: Depending on the value of your home and the amount of equity you have, you may be able to borrow a larger sum of money with a home equity loan.
Tax benefits: In some cases, the interest paid on a home equity loan may be tax-deductible, providing potential financial advantages.

Comparing Interest Rates And Terms
One of the primary factors to consider when choosing a debt consolidation loan is the interest rate. Interest rates can vary significantly between different lenders, and even a small difference in interest rates can have a substantial impact on the overall cost of the loan. Comparing interest rates allows military personnel to find the most affordable option for their financial situation.
In addition to interest rates, it is essential to examine the loan terms. Some lenders may offer a fixed interest rate, meaning the rate remains the same throughout the life of the loan, while others may provide variable interest rates that can change over time. Additionally, the loan term, or the length of time it will take to repay the loan, should be considered. A longer loan term may result in lower monthly payments but may also lead to paying more in interest over time. Military personnel should carefully evaluate the interest rates and terms offered by different lenders to choose the most advantageous debt consolidation loan option.

Can Military Members With Bad Credit Apply For Debt Consolidation Loans?
Yes, military members with bad credit can still apply for debt consolidation loans. These loans are available to military personnel with various credit scores, including those with less-than-perfect credit. However, the interest rates and terms offered to individuals with bad credit may be different from those with good credit.
How Does Debt Consolidation Affect Military Members’ Credit Scores?
Debt consolidation can potentially have a positive impact on military members’ credit scores. By streamlining their debts and making on-time payments, borrowers can demonstrate responsible financial behavior, leading to a boost in their credit scores over time. However, it is important to continue practicing good credit habits to maintain a positive score.
